What type of energy conversion is in a car?
The internal combustion engine in the car converts the potential chemical energy in gasoline and oxygen into thermal energy which is transformed into the mechanical energy that accelerates the vehicle (increasing its kinetic energy) by causing the pressure and performing the work on the pistons.
What kinds of energy are involved in moving a car down the road?
Your moving vehicle has kinetic energy; as you increase your vehicle’s speed, your vehicle’s kinetic energy increases. The greater your vehicle’s kinetic energy, the greater the effort that will be required to stop the vehicle.

Which is an example of kinetic energy answer com?
Kinetic energy is the energy of motion, observable as the movement of an object, particle, or set of particles. Any object in motion is using kinetic energy: a person walking, a thrown baseball, a crumb falling from a table, and a charged particle in an electric field are all examples of kinetic energy at work.

How does conservation of energy work in a car?
It is converted into heat and disappears into the surrounding air. Energy conservation is valid since the chemical energy ends up as thermal energy leaving the car as heat. No energy is disappearing from this world, no energy is created out of the blue – one energy form is just converted into some other energy form.
